Dolores W. Smithson

January 7, 1935 — February 28, 2026

Springville

Dolores Williams Smithson passed away February 28, 2026. She was married to William M. Smithson (deceased 1998) and had four sons: Richard Lee Smithson (Brenda, d. 2014), Randal Allen Smithson (Minnie), Ronald Carl Smithson (Lindy) and Russell Earl Smithson (Tina).

Dolores was the Head Librarian for Tarrant City Library, retiring after 25 years of dedicated service. She also served as President of the Jefferson County Library Association Board.

She enjoyed going to church, teaching Sunday School for many years, singing soprano in the choir, and was featured as an occasional soloist. Dolores dedicated many years to Women’s Missionary Union, delivered Meals on Wheels, and actively participated in numerous Christian ministries throughout her life.

After retirement, she spent a considerable amount of time traveling the world, engaging in various Christian mission projects, and volunteering as an aid in disaster relief with the Southern Baptist Convention. She continued to devote her life to Christ until the very end, financially supporting various ministries and spreading the gospel.

Dolores was a devout Christian, wife, and mother. She leaves behind a legacy of love, kindness, and unwavering faith. Her nurturing spirit and commitment to Christ touched the lives of many, both in her community and around the world.

In addition to her immediate family, Dolores is survived by her cherished daughters-in-law and multiple beloved grandchildren and great grandchildren.

Her family takes solace in knowing that she has been reunited with her beloved husband, William, and that her spirit continues to inspire those who knew her. A funeral service will be held in her honor March 5, 2026 at Jefferson Memorial in Trussville, Alabama at 2 pm with visitation beginning at 1pm, where family and friends are invited to celebrate her life and the impact she had on all who were fortunate enough to cross her path.

In lieu of flowers, the family requests that donations be made to the Sumariton’s Purse , ensuring that her commitment to Christ carries on.
